Subject: Commercial Insurance Renewal — Action Required

Finance team, our commercial policy with Ardenhall Mutual renews at month end. Premiums rise roughly 6%, reflecting the expanded Westfold warehouse coverage. I recommend we accept the renewal terms rather than retender this late in the cycle. Please confirm budget allocation by Thursday. The broader coverage strategy this renewal supports is explained in the confidential note below.

confidential, kagep-kahof: Druokax Systems plans to lower the Ulaath list price by 53 percent in March.

### Changelog — tidescope-widget v3.4.2

Quick one for the sync: we rotated the signing key for the Tidescope tide-table widget after the old one hit its scheduled expiry. Nothing dramatic — builds from the Gullsperch pipeline now sign with the new identity, and the Saltmere CDN verifier was updated Tuesday. If your local verify step starts complaining, just refresh your trust store. The new signing key is below for reference.

release key, fajef-kajeg: bky19_LdLu6Ne6FLi8he2c24d

Ticket #4471 — Signature verification failed on Brindlewood build farm

The nightly Quillon release failed its signature check because agent bw-07's clock drifted nine minutes behind the signing server, so the timestamp on the manifest fell outside the validity window. NTP has been fixed and the agent re-enrolled. To re-sign and republish the artifact, use the key that follows:

release key, fahaf-bajof: bky3_Xam

## Authentication

Before you can run the Mergewell dedupe jobs, you'll need access to the internal Recordspan API — that's where candidate duplicate pairs get fetched and merge decisions get written back. Auth is a single bearer key passed in the request header; no OAuth dance, nothing fancy. Grab it from the snippet below and drop it into your `.env` as-is:

app token of tadug-yahag = vxb3-949